Estelle made a frame by recycling a wooden plank. For the background she used a Simon Says Stamp Blossom Field Embossing Folder and used Distress Inks to add color. She used a Tim Holtz Classics #5 cling stamp set and a Flourish Layering Stencil. She used Distress Ink Re-Inkers to color the face.

Andrea used a Swiss Dots embossing folder to add texture to her tag. She cut the tag shape using Waffle Flower’s Nesting Tags die set and added some text using Seth Apter’s ESA34 stamp set. The patterned paper in the background is from Spellbinders’ Hello It’s Me set.

Anna-Karin made a grungy tag with a heat embossed background. Tim Holtz Number Blocks stamps were used for the background together with Simon Says Stamp Clear Embossing Powder. The little flowers were die cut with Simon Says Stamp Poised Primula die.

Barbara made her Memorydex for May using the Tim Holtz Sizzix Roses 3D Embossing Folder. She used some Distress Ink pads to color the roses and used Ranger Ink Embossing Clear Powder to make them shiny. She created the background with the Flourish stencil in the mini version (mini set 10) and a stamp from the Tim Holtz Stampers Anonymous French Marketplace set.

Kath decorated a Kraft Gift Bag to give to a gardening friend using Tim Holtz/Sizzix Typewriter Texture Fade, the florals from Tim Holtz/Sizzix Vault Floristry Side-Order Thinlits, coloured in Summer Distress Oxide colours – Abandoned Coral and Evergreen Bough and added Tim Holtz/Idea-ology Specimen Remnant Rubs.

Macarena keeps going with bright colors and for this card she embossed Tim Holtz Abstract Florals Stamps with Simon Says Stamp Clear Embossing Powder. She added a layered tag from Elizabeth Craft Designs Tag Variety Pack Dies and Tim Holtz Distress Crackle Paste Translucent for the background.

Maura combined an ATC with an art journal page using Tracy Evans Seedbeds stamp set, Simon Says Stamp’s Clear Embossing Powder, and stencils like the Simon Says Stamp Monstera stencil.

Meihsia was inspired to create a mixed media tag using Tim Holtz Cling Rubber Stamps THE PROFESSOR on the background, embossed it with Hero Arts EMBOSS CLEAR EMBOSSING POWDER and decorated it with Tim Holtz idea-ology PAPER DOLLS PORTRAiTS.

Zoey used Gold Embossing powder and Numbered embossing folder for the theme. She also used Ideaology photobooth to decorate her tag. Inks and sprays are from the distress ink line
